IN pin are ignored. However, the INH pin can still be used to switch both MOSFETs off.
After tCLS the switches return to their initial setting. The error signal at the IS pin is reset
after 2 * tCLS. Unintentional triggering of the current limitation by short current spikes
(e.g. inflicted by EMI coming from the motor) is suppressed by internal filter circuitry. Due
to thresholds and reaction delay times of the filter circuitry the effective current limitation
level ICLx depends on the slew rate of the load current dI/dt as shown in Figure 10
